This domain has one supplier layer, not two: strategy and governance work is advisory, so there is no product to license and every company here is a delivery firm. They divide by where their leverage sits — management consultancies that argue the business case to a board, and engineering-led firms that write a roadmap they could execute themselves. Evaluate them on whether the deliverable is a portfolio decision you can act on or a document: ask for the assessment method, the rationalization criteria, and who owns the resulting sequencing. Because no company here commits to an implementation approach, this page carries no approach axis; the migration paths and services in this hub's siblings are where those commitments are documented. Companies appear alphabetically, and every one of them is enterprise-scale — this is not a market with a boutique tier.
